Help - 964 3.6 intake and exhaust valve lift
I'm installing a set of EBS V-max valve springs, seats, and retainers. The car has stock cams, rockers, pistons, etc. I can't find the intake and exhaust valve lift anywhere in the shop manuals (I'm probably missing it), which is the preferred method as per their instructions for setting the spring height with these valve springs.
I found the stock intake and exhaust spring height, but I can't find any cam lift specs. Can anyone help me please? I'm help up until I figure this out.

.470" Intake lift
.430" Exhaust lift
